Commit 1d105f52 authored by sajolida's avatar sajolida
Browse files

Don't break the test suite when changing the headline of /home (Will-fix: #12156)

The test suite needs a stable <title> but ikiwiki uses [[!meta title]]
for both <title> and the page headline.

This commit overwrites <title> using JavaScript.

Using "Tails" as <title> is generic enough to make sense while
preventing to have to handle translations.
parent 004ba585
......@@ -407,7 +407,7 @@ end
Given /^the Tor Browser loads the (startup page|Tails homepage|Tails roadmap)$/ do |page|
case page
when "startup page"
title = 'Tails - News'
title = 'Tails'
when "Tails homepage"
title = 'Tails - Privacy for anyone anywhere'
when "Tails roadmap"
......
[[!meta title="News"]]
<!-- Changing this title breaks the test suite. See #12134#note-7. -->
[[!meta title="Welcome to Tails"]]
[[!meta robots="noindex"]]
[[!meta script="home"]]
<div id="tor_check">
<a href="https://check.torproject.org/">
[[!img "lib/onion.png" link="no"]]
......
document.addEventListener('DOMContentLoaded', function() {
document.title = "Tails";
});
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ment